Bionano Announces 67% Year-Over-Year Growth in Studies Featuring Optical Genome Mapping at ESHG 2026, Reflecting Expanding Global Adoption
June 18, 2026 8:00 AM EDTSAN DIEGO, June 18,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Bionano Genomics, Inc. (Nasdaq: BNGO) today announced that studies featuring optical genome mapping (OGM) at the 2026 European Society of Human Genetics (ESHG) conference grew substantially compared to the conference in 2025, consistent with expanding global adoption of OGM.
Key highlights from studies of OGM presented at ESHG 2026:
